Ingredients

Servings 1
  • 350 ml Dr Pepper-style soda
  • 20 ml Coconut syrup
  • ½ Lime
  • 30 ml Half-and-half
  • 150 g Ice cubes (optional)

Method

  1. Fill a tall glass with ice and pour the soda over, leaving room at the top.
  2. Stir in the coconut syrup and squeeze in the lime, dropping the wedge into the glass.
  3. Pour the half-and-half slowly over the back of a spoon so it cascades through — swirl once and serve with a straw.

About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da

This classic coconut-lime dirty soda is the drink widely credited with launching the whole 'dirty soda' craze out of Utah's soda shops. It starts from a Dr Pepper-style soda rather than cola, and its defining trio is coconut syrup, fresh lime and a creamy float of half-and-half. That base of a spiced, dark soda is exactly what makes this combination work — its layered cola-and-cherry-like flavor stands up to the coconut and citrus in a way a plainer soda can't.

Poured over ice, stirred with coconut syrup and a good squeeze of lime, then finished with half-and-half cascaded over the back of a spoon, it drinks sweet, creamy and tangy all at once, with the fizz and cold ice keeping everything lively. The lime is essential — it cuts the sweetness and stops the drink from feeling flat. Ready in around four minutes and entirely alcohol-free, it is the original template that every other dirty soda riffs on, and a fun, fast treat for anyone who wants the soda-fountain experience at home.

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da: frequently asked questions

How many calories are in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da?

A serving has about 281 calories — 1.1g protein, 61.2g carbs, 3.8g fat, 0.1g fiber. Figures are estimated from the ingredient amounts and will shift with your portions and brands.

Is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da gluten-free?

Based on its ingredients,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da has no gluten-containing components, so it's naturally gluten-free — as always, check that any packaged ingredients you use are certified gluten-free to be safe.

Is Classic Coconut-Lime Dirty Soda dairy-free?

Not as written — it uses Half-and-half. Swapping it for a plant-based alternative makes it dairy-free.
